Is the Samsung S26 Ultra actually worth the price, or is the internet controversy justified? After 2 full months of daily driving Samsung’s most talked-about flagship as my primary device, I’m sharing my honest long-term review to reveal if it truly delivers. From the polarizing privacy display to real-world battery life, here is what no one told you at launch.
In this video, we break down our real-world experience using the Samsung Galaxy S26 Ultra completely without a case. We dive deep into the highly debated 6.9-inch privacy display feature, comparing it directly to traditional privacy screen guards, exploring its app integration, and addressing the subtle overheating and brightness concerns raised by tech enthusiasts. Is the display quality as bad as people claim, or is it a game-changer for professional use?
Beyond the display, we put the One UI 8.5 stability to the test against the iPhone, review the daily performance of the processor under extreme 45°C heat, and look closely at the real screen-on-time (SOT) battery stats with and without Always On Display (AOD). Finally, we compare the simple point-and-shoot camera experience and 12MP selfie performance against heavy-hitting flagships from Xiaomi, Vivo, and Oppo, and answer your burning audience questions about Dolby Vision, the 3x telephoto sensor, and S-Pen utility.
